{"id":9217,"date":"2019-05-15T16:15:18","date_gmt":"2019-05-15T14:15:18","guid":{"rendered":"https:\/\/www.riccardomuti.com\/?p=9217"},"modified":"2021-06-01T08:39:47","modified_gmt":"2021-06-01T06:39:47","slug":"the-chicago-symphony-ends-its-longest-strike-2","status":"publish","type":"post","link":"https:\/\/www.riccardomuti.com\/en\/2019\/05\/15\/the-chicago-symphony-ends-its-longest-strike-2\/","title":{"rendered":"Chicago Symphony Ends Its Longest Strike With Pension Change"},"content":{"rendered":"<h6 style=\"text-align: center;\"><span class=\"css-8i9d0s e13ogyst0\">Riccardo Muti leading the Chicago Symphony Orchestra, whose players voted on Saturday to end<br \/>\nthe longest strike in the orchestra\u2019s 128-year history.<br \/>\n<\/span><span class=\"emkp2hg2 css-1nwzsjy e1z0qqy90\">Hiroyuki Ito for The New York Times<\/span><\/h6>\n<p>&nbsp;<\/p>\n<h3 style=\"text-align: left;\"><strong style=\"font-size: 16px;\"><span class=\"balancedHeadline\">Chicago Symphony Ends Its Longest Strike With Pension Change<\/span><\/strong><\/h3>\n<div class=\"css-1fanzo5 StoryBodyCompanionColumn\">\n<div class=\"css-53u6y8\">\n<p>\u2013 di <span class=\"css-1baulvz\">Michael Cooper<\/span> | April, 27<\/p>\n<div class=\"css-1fanzo5 StoryBodyCompanionColumn\">\n<div class=\"css-53u6y8\">\n<p class=\"css-1ygdjhk evys1bk0\">The longest strike in the Chicago Symphony Orchestra\u2019s 128-year history ended Saturday, when the orchestra\u2019s musicians and board agreed to a new contract that will shift the players from their defined-benefit pension to a defined-contribution plan, similar to a 401(k).<\/p>\n<p class=\"css-1ygdjhk evys1bk0\">The proposed change to the pension plan was the major sticking point in a musicians\u2019 strike that lasted nearly seven weeks. The deal was brokered with the help of Chicago\u2019s mayor, Rahm Emanuel, who had called the players\u2019 union and the orchestra\u2019s management to his office on Friday to try to break the stalemate.<\/p>\n<p class=\"css-1ygdjhk evys1bk0\">The orchestra\u2019s management had said that the existing pension plan, which guaranteed the players a set amount in retirement, had grown too costly. The players countered that the proposed alternative, in which the orchestra would put a set amount of money into individual retirement accounts, would shift investment risk to the musicians.<\/p>\n<p class=\"css-1ygdjhk evys1bk0\">The two sides came up with a compromise. The orchestra\u2019s management said that when current players switch to the new defined-contribution plan and agree to invest their retirement accounts prudently, the orchestra will guarantee that their benefits at retirement will be the same as what they would have earned under the old pension plan, which is being frozen.<\/p>\n<\/div>\n<\/div>\n<div class=\"css-1fanzo5 StoryBodyCompanionColumn\">\n<div class=\"css-53u6y8\">\n<p class=\"css-1ygdjhk evys1bk0\">That guarantee will not be available to new players: Those hired after July 1, 2020, will immediately move into the new plan, in which 7.5 percent of their base salary will be placed into retirement accounts.<\/p>\n<p class=\"css-1ygdjhk evys1bk0\">The other major issue was wages. The new contract will include raises in each of the five years of the contract \u2014 of 2, 2, 2.5, 3.25 and 3.5 percent \u2014 which will bring the base salary to $181,272 in the final year, management said.<\/p>\n<p class=\"css-1ygdjhk evys1bk0\">The strike attracted the attention of orchestras nationwide, which have been under pressure to curb expenses, especially during contract negotiations with their unions. While defined-benefit pensions have grown rarer in the private sector, they are still the norm among the nation\u2019s leading orchestras. So musicians from around the country watched closely to see whether the Chicago players would succeed in protecting theirs.<\/p>\n<p class=\"css-1ygdjhk evys1bk0\">The musicians\u2019 union said in a statement that the new deal \u201cpreserves guaranteed minimum retirement benefits for current musicians and commits the parties to study options for providing retirement security for new hires.\u201d In the past, unions have been loath to accept contract changes that would protect current workers at the expense of new hires, fearing that such deals would create two tiers of workers in the same orchestra.<\/p>\n<p class=\"css-1ygdjhk evys1bk0\">The strike was also notable for the unusual involvement of the orchestra\u2019s revered music director, Riccardo Muti, since conductors usually avoid seeming to take sides in labor disputes. But before the strike began, Mr. Muti wrote to the orchestra\u2019s board and management, saying, \u201cI am with the musicians,\u201d and he later appeared with the players on the picket line.<\/p>\n<\/div>\n<\/div>\n<div class=\"css-1fanzo5 StoryBodyCompanionColumn\">\n<div class=\"css-53u6y8\">\n<p class=\"css-1ygdjhk evys1bk0\">While Mr. Muti publicly insisted that he simply wanted the management and the board to \u201clisten more carefully to the needs of musicians who represent one of the greatest orchestras in the world,\u201d the symbolism was hard to miss. He is scheduled to return to the orchestra\u2019s podium this week, which added pressure on both sides to reach an agreement.<\/p>\n<p class=\"css-1ygdjhk evys1bk0\">Steve Lester, a bassist in the orchestra who was the chairman of the musicians\u2019 negotiating committee, said in a statement that \u201cafter about a year of negotiations, we are victorious in our efforts by protecting and maintaining our secure retirement and gaining lost ground on our annual salaries.\u201d<\/p>\n<p class=\"css-1ygdjhk evys1bk0\">Helen Zell, the chairwoman of the orchestra\u2019s board, said in a statement that the new agreement \u201censures that the musicians receive the outstanding compensation they deserve\u201d while securing the orchestra\u2019s \u201clong-term financial sustainability through the retirement plan transition.\u201d<\/p>\n<\/div>\n<\/div>\n<\/div>\n<\/div>\n<div class=\"css-1fanzo5 StoryBodyCompanionColumn\">\n<div class=\"css-53u6y8\">\n<p class=\"css-1ygdjhk evys1bk0\" style=\"text-align: right;\"><span class=\"css-1baulvz\">Michael Cooper, <em>The New York Times<\/em>, April 27<\/span><\/p>\n<\/div>\n<hr \/>\n<h3><strong>CSO, Riccardo Muti return in triumphant program following strike settlement<\/strong><\/h3>\n<p>\u2013 di Kyle MacMillan | <span class=\"css-1baulvz\">May 3<\/span><\/p>\n<p>The biggest news from Thursday evening\u2019s Chicago Symphony Orchestra concert is that the event took place at all.<\/p>\n<p>After a seven-week strike, the orchestra returned to Orchestra Hall for the first time following the management and musicians signing a new labor agreement last weekend with the intervention of Mayor Rahm Emanuel. And the audience was clearly glad to see the ensemble back.<\/p>\n<p>A homemade sign with the words, \u201cWelcome Home,\u201d hung briefly over the side of the balcony above the stage. And when the lights brightened above the stage signaling the imminent start of the concert, applause and cheers began, growing in intensity as concertmaster Robert Chen came out to take his bow.<\/p>\n<p>More cheers and a partial standing ovation greeted music director Riccardo Muti when he took the stage. He launched the orchestra into a performance of \u201cThe Star-Spangled Banner,\u201d which it usually plays at the start of each season, but this concert felt like a kind of new beginning and the gesture seemed appropriate.<\/p>\n<p>Beyond the much-anticipated restart of the 2018-19 season, Thursday\u2019s program was marked with some other notable milestones and historical connections. First off, two of the featured composers, Georges Bizet and Hector Berlioz, were both winners of the much-coveted Prix de Rome competition.<\/p>\n<p>In January 1926, Ottorino Respighi traveled to Chicago to serve as soloist in his then-new piano concerto and to lead performances of his now-celebrated symphonic poem, \u201cPines of Rome,\u201d just days after its American premiere in New York under Arturo Toscanini.<\/p>\n<p>Thursday evening opened with the Chicago Symphony\u2019s first complete performance of Bizet\u2019s \u201cRoma\u201d since 1894, a bizarrely long time considering the innate appeal of this overlooked early suite, which the composer began writing in his early 20s during his residency in Rome. (Muti has a knack for musical rediscoveries like this.)<\/p>\n<p>Like \u201cPines of Rome,\u201d which concluded the concert, \u201cRoma\u201d offered the ideal festive spirit for this reprisal of the season, with its rich orchestrations, fetching harmonies and scene-setting imagery. This was easy-listening in the best sense of the term.<\/p>\n<p>Muti and the orchestra brought an appropriately light, relaxed feel to this music, delivering apt doses of gentleness during the pastoral sections and rhythmic thrust in the more upbeat moments, including plenty of snap and sparkle in the lively second movement. Deserving special note were principal clarinetist Stephen Williamson\u2019s handsome solos sprinkled throughout and the exuberant French horn calls in the first movement.<\/p>\n<p style=\"text-align:
